There I came across this sentence
Mama bought me an old airplane magazine. It's older than her.
I wonder if it should have been written this way below
Mama bought me an old airplane magazine. It's older them she.

You’re right. I’ve an old rule that says the case of a pronoun following the word “than” is determined by mentally supplying the verb after it. Therefore, “... It's older than she [not "her"] (is).” is correct.

You are older than me. OR You are older than I am.
It is older than her. OR It is older than she is.
